Abstract

The invention relates to a modular cold and hot water air conditioning unit intelligent joint control system and a control method. According to the system and method, temperature and humidity parameters of indoor and outdoor areas of an office building are acquired, precise group control is performed on the operating power of an air conditioning unit according to the cold (hot) air enthalpy valuesrequired by the office building areas and the work efficiency of the air conditioning unit, the optimal energy consumption operating mode is established by means of the unique power-saving intelligent control procedure based on acquired data including the operating temperature, pressure, flow rate and the like of the air conditioning unit as well as a series of parameters such as the height, orientation, materials, the thermal load, indoor and outdoor temperature and humidity conditions of the building and the user using habit, building load variation is automatically tracked, dynamic predicting, advanced adjustment and synchronous optimization are achieved, finally, the central air conditioning parameters of temperature, pressure, flow rate and the like are adjusted, the power curve is made to approach the power curve required by an actual load as close as possible under the condition that the requirements of an end system for the temperature, pressure, flow rate and the like are met, the energy-saving effect of air conditioners is pushed to the limit, and the purpose of system energy-saving optimization is achieved.

Description

technical field [0001] The invention belongs to the technical field of central air-conditioning, in particular to an intelligent joint control system and control method of a modular cold and hot water air-conditioning unit. Background technique [0002] At present, most office buildings and office buildings use modular air-cooled cold (hot) water air conditioning units to provide cooling in summer and heating in winter. There are nearly 8 months of continuous working time throughout the year. [0003] The existing air-conditioning unit has a simple control process, and only operates according to the set power without considering the use of the air-conditioning area, and it is impossible to accurately control the operation of the air-conditioning unit according to the required air enthalpy.
